XINA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2019 in Review
0 of the 4,604 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in SPDR MSCI China A Shares IMI ETF (XINA) for Q2 2019, worth a combined $0 — down 100% from $1.01M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 3 funds closed out of XINA and 0 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 0 trimmed existing stakes and 0 added.
The largest seller was Credit Suisse, exiting entirely with an estimated $656K sold.
